26th Annual Bar H Championship Rodeo & Country Festival
The Bar H Arena in Boiling Springs will be hosting the 26th annual Bar H Championship Rodeo & Country Festival on Friday, May 10 and Saturday, May 11. The country festival begins each evening at 6:00 pm and the championship rodeo begins each evening at 8:00 pm. The admission price includes the country festival and championship rodeo.

Bruce Camp's Local Fishing Report April 25th Edition
Bruce Camp's Local Fishing Report April 25th Edition
Kosa
The retirees fished Lake Wylie last week and knew going in it would be better than the previous weeks event on Lake Norman. Ronnie Humphries brought in 10.0 and captured the win, Larry Melton was second with 8.95 and in third was Ken Johnson and Fred Wright with 7.30. John Black and Roger McNeely had a 2.90 largemouth and that was big bass of the day. This week its back to Lake Norman and hopes for revenge against the lake.

Blue Ridge Music Trails Welcomes Clear Mountain View Music Festival
Blue Ridge Music Trails Welcomes Clear Mountain View Music Festival
The overwhelming support of the Clear Mountain View Music Festival and other events held at Elliott Family Farms in Lawndale has been humbling.  The Clear Mountain View Music Festival, scheduled for August 22-25, has been accepted as an event for the Blue Ridge Heritage Area Music Trail even though Cleveland County is not technically part of the National Heritage Area.
